Форум вопросов и ответов

Форум вопросов и ответов (https://www.otvetnemail.ru/)
-   Второй архив вопросов и ответов (https://www.otvetnemail.ru/vtoroj-arhiv-voprosov-i-otvetov-801/)
-   -   Проблемы работы с базой данных (https://www.otvetnemail.ru/vtoroj-arhiv-voprosov-i-otvetov-801/problemy-raboty-s-bazoj-dannyh-245940/)

Guest 28.09.2011 07:32

Проблемы работы с базой данных
 
Пытаюсь создать таблицу в базе данных:Код:$db1 =& JFactory::getDBO(); $query = 'CREATE TABLE IF NOT EXISTS `#__table1` ( `rowid` integer NOT NULL AUTO_INCREMENT, `name` varchar(255) NOT NULL DEFAULT ``, `artist` varchar(80) NOT NULL DEFAULT ``, `title` varchar(80) NOT NULL DEFAULT ``, `down_count` integer NOT NULL DEFAULT 0, `raiting` integer NOT NULL DEFAULT 0, PRIMARY KEY (`rowid`), UNIQUE KEY `music_name` (`name`,`artist`,`title`) );'; $result = $db1->setQuery($query); if (!$result = $db1->query($query)){ echo "Error: ".$db1->getError();// отлавливаем ошибки }Код выполняется внутри функции. Вернее должен выполняться. Всё остальное внутри функции выполняется. А этот код почему-то нет! Таблица не создаётся! В чём может быть проблема?


Часовой пояс GMT, время: 11:13.


© www.otvetnemail.ru - Форум вопросов и ответов.